Best areas and cities in Saudi Arabia for buying offices and real estate investment

tops the list of preferred destinations for buying offices, as it is the political and economic capital and the focus of major investments. The strongest investment opportunities are concentrated in the northern and central districts, near King Abdullah Financial District (KAFD), King Fahd Road, and Prince Mohammed bin Salman Road. These areas are the business nerve center, where major companies and banks are located, ensuring high and continuous demand for office spaces. Investment here mainly targets major companies and institutions seeking luxury and strategic locations that reflect their prestige. With the completion of the Riyadh Metro network, the areas surrounding the main stations have become smart investment attractions due to the ease of access for employees and clients, increasing the rental value per square meter.

comes as an important commercial and tourist gateway on the Red Sea, featuring an active office market serving logistics, trade, and tourism sectors. The vital office areas in Jeddah are concentrated on main axes such as King Abdulaziz Road, Prince Sultan Road, and the Tahlia area, which combine commercial vitality with upscale services. In the Eastern Province, are a main center for the energy, industry, and support services sectors, where engineering and oil companies seek offices with specific technical specifications. Best types of real estate and offices for sale in Saudi Arabia

"Shell & Core" system, which are spaces delivered without interior finishes and are the preferred option for large companies and investors who want to divide and design the space according to their needs and visual identity, or to rent it to companies that prefer to implement their own decor. This type offers high flexibility but requires additional time and budget for fit-out before operation. On the other hand, there are "Fully Fitted" offices, which are ready for immediate use and suit small and medium companies wishing to start operations quickly without construction and fit-out complications, and are an excellent choice for investors seeking quick leasing of units.

entire office floors providing complete privacy for large companies, and offices within mixed-use towers combining residential, commercial, and hotel functions, offering a vibrant environment and integrated services in one place. Recently, business parks have also emerged, providing a horizontal work environment with green spaces and shared facilities that enhance employee quality of life. What determines the "average prices" of offices in Saudi Arabia?

strategic location and ease of access at the forefront; buildings located on main arterial roads or near vital landmarks are more expensive than those on backstreets. Building quality and classification (Grade A, B, C) also play a crucial role, as Grade A buildings feature luxury finishes, smart building management systems (BMS), fast elevators, and sustainability certificates (such as LEED), significantly increasing their cost and market and rental value compared to older traditional buildings that may lack modern infrastructure.

ratio of allocated parking spaces per office, as some commercial areas suffer from a shortage of parking, making units that provide enough parking for employees and visitors much more valuable. Additionally, delivery condition (shell or fitted), view, and the availability of facility management, security, and maintenance services affect the final price. Some buyers overlook "common service fees" when evaluating the price, which are periodic fees for maintaining common areas, elevators, and central air conditioning. Regulatory considerations and common risks and how to reduce them

building permits and land use; it is necessary to ensure that the building is officially licensed as "commercial/administrative" in the title deed and that the activity you intend to practice is allowed in that specific area according to municipal and civil defense requirements. Some buildings may be designated for certain uses or have restrictions on electrical loads or working hours, which may not suit your company's activity. It is also essential to verify that the property is free of any legal disputes or mortgages that could delay the transfer of ownership, which we verify through official channels.
